In a new installation of Quantal, I find that the PDF printer driver installed by cups-pdf is not working.

Regular printing to an HP Laserjet under the hplip package works fine.

Has anyone else experienced this?

I have two HP printers, one connected to a parallel port, and the other a network printer connected via wireless.

I have been able to print with no problems, including via printing directly from within LibreOffice Writer.

I know I use the hplip package for my network printer, but the other one, I configured.

I have other computers in my network using both the wireless printer, and the one connected via a parallel port to my main computer. The main computer is configured to export its printers, and other machines make use of it.

It seems that I had one of the other computers set up to use that parallel-connected (exported) printer, but later, after updates were installed (that included CUPS updates), it seems that configuration disappeared, and I had to re-configure it (the other computer didn't see any exported printers any more).
